raceless go is a nicer go

This commit is contained in:
2025-11-26 09:13:03 +00:00
parent 8aaa536a2a
commit cc2c9b948b
4 changed files with 11 additions and 6 deletions

View File

@@ -1,4 +1,8 @@
{ pkgs, go }:
{
pkgs,
go,
nicer,
}:
let
go-script = pkgs.writeShellScript "go-raceless" ''
args=("$@")
@@ -22,11 +26,11 @@ let
done
if [[ "$found_race" == "true" ]]; then
exec ${go}/bin/go "''${new_args[@]}"
exec ${nicer}/bin/nicer ${go}/bin/go "''${new_args[@]}"
fi
fi
exec ${go}/bin/go "$@"
exec ${nicer}/bin/nicer ${go}/bin/go "$@"
'';
preservedAttrs = pkgs.lib.attrsets.getAttrs [